Przegląd modeli konstytutywnych dla tkanek żywych

Piotr Kowalczyk

The paper presents a review of constitutive models recently applied in the mechanical analysis of living tissues. The mechanical properties of the basic microstructural components of animal tissues (connective tissue fibers, hydroxyapatite, muscular cells) are discussed. Next, on the basis of available literature, a series of constitutive models for various tissues is presented. The models are classified in regard to the type of constitutive relations. Three basic groups of models are distinguished: viscoelastic, nonlinearly-elastic and linearly-elastic. Examples of constitutive eąuations are provided, followed by the discussion of their properties and range of applicability.
